A Student of Cosmic Malevolence
He clings to a fleeting image A man sipping wine on a train Racing through a cloudless And ever so bloodless night
What of man’s universal sorrow A cosmic lapse Something small Absolutely critical in effect
An arachnid spins a web God of its universe Spilling from it entrails
A careless thought A lazy daydream A ghost of limbo
The world’s cobweb goes crazy Everything out of kilter Black holes appear in the memory
We dance with Name the snakes Curling in our minds Give voice and words to them While the god-like spider Waits ever so patiently
